2_06不规则三角网模型与结构

合集下载

不规则三角网(TIN)的建立PPT文档资料

不规则三角网(TIN)的建立PPT文档资料
• 这种算法大量的时间花费在符合要求的邻域点的 搜索方面,为了减少搜索时间,许多学者提出了 许多不同的方法,如将数据分块并排列,以外接 圆的方式限定其搜索范围。
2020/9/23
16
2 1
2 13
递归生长算法
2020/9/23
2 13
2 13
17
1、三角网生长算法
2)凸闭包收缩法
该算法的基本思路:首先找到包含数据区域的最小凸多边 形,并从该多边形开始从外向里逐层形成三角形格网。
用来进行TIN构建的原始数据根据数据点之间的约束 条件可分为无约束数据域和约束数据域两种类型。
无约束数据域是指数据点之间不存在任何关系,即 数据分布完全呈离散状态,数据点之间在物理上相互 独立。
约束数据域则是部分数据点之间存在着某种联系, 这种联系一般通过线性特征来维护,如地形数据中的 山脊线、山谷线上的点等。
2020/9/23
11
• 关于delaunay三角网
• 1934年Delaunay提出了Voronoi图的对称图, 即Delaunay三角网(用直线段连接两个相邻 多边形内的离散点而生成的三角网)。
– Delaunay三角网的特性:
• 不存在四点共圆; • 每个三角形对应于一个Voronoi图顶点; • 每个三角形边对应于一个Voronoi图边; • 每个结点对应于一个Voronoi图区域; • Delaunay图的边界是一个凸壳; • 三角网中三角形的最小角最大。
2020/9/23
14
1、三角网生长算法
三角网生长算法就是从一个“源”开始,逐步形成 覆盖整个数据区域的三角网。
从生长过程角度,三角网生长算法分为收缩生长算 法和扩张生长算法两类。
收缩生长算法是先形成整个数据域的数据边界(凸 壳),并以此作为源头,逐步缩小以形成整个三角网。

不规则三角网(TIN)

不规则三角网(TIN)

不规则三角网(TIN)Ⅰ 数字高程模型(DEM)地球表面高低起伏,呈现一种连续变化的曲面,这种曲面无法用平面地图来确切表示。

于是我们就利用一种全新的数字地球表面的方法——数字高程模型的方法,这种方法已被普遍广泛采用。

数字高程模型即DEM(Digital Elevation Model),是以数字形式按一定结构组织在一起,表示实际地形特征空间分布的模型,也是地形形状大小和起伏的数字描述。

DEM有三种主要的表示模型:规则格网模型,等高线模型和不规则三角网。

格网(即GRID)DEM在地形平坦的地方,存在大量的数据冗余,在不改变格网大小情况下,难以表达复杂地形的突变现象,在某些计算,如通视问题,过分强调网格的轴方向。

不规则三角网(简称TIN,即Triangulated Irregular Network)是另外一种表示数字高程模型的的方法(Peuker等,1978),它既减少了规则格网带来的数据冗余,同时在计算(如坡度)效率方面又优于纯粹基于等高线的方法。

不规则三角网能随地形起伏变化的复杂性而改变采样点的密度和决定采样点的位置,因而它能够避免地形起伏平坦时的数据冗余,又能按地形特征点如山脊,山谷线,地形变化线等表示数字高程特征。

Ⅱ TIN的基本知识在TIN中,满足最佳三角形的条件为:尽可能的保证三角形的三个角都是锐角,三角形的三条边近似相等,最小角最大化。

TIN 是基于矢量的数字地理数据的一种形式,通过将一系列折点(点)组成三角形来构建。

形成这些三角形的插值方法有很多种,例如Delaunay 三角测量法或距离排序法。

ArcGIS 支持Delaunay 三角测量方法。

TIN 的单位是英尺或米等长度单位,而不是度分秒。

当使用地理坐标系的角度坐标进行构建时,Delaunay 三角测量无效。

创建TIN 时,应使用投影坐标系(PCS)。

TIN 模型的适用范围不及栅格表面模型那么广泛,且构建和处理所需的开销更大。

获得优良源数据的成本可能会很高,并且,由于数据结构非常复杂,处理TIN 的效率要比处理栅格数据低。

不规则三角网DE

不规则三角网DE

长沙理工大学测绘工程系 谢树春
不规则三角网DEM 不规则三角网DEM
基于张角最大准则的Delaunay三角网建立 五. 基于张角最大准则的 三角网建立
张角最大准则: 张角最大准则:
指一点到基边的张角为最大。 指一点到基边的张角为最大。 张角为最大
与空外接圆准则等价。 与空外接圆准则等价。 等价
长沙理工大学测绘工程系 谢树春
不规则三角网DEM 不规则三角网DEM
一.概念
不规则三角网( 不规则三角网(Triangulated Irregular Network, TIN)DEM是由 ) 是由 优化组合联结而成的连续三角面 不规则分布的有限个地形离散点按优化组合联结而成的连续三角面。 不规则分布的有限个地形离散点按优化组合联结而成的连续三角面。
长沙理工大学测绘工程系 谢树春
LOP算法实现新点 插入的过程: 算法实现新点p插入的过程 算法实现新点 插入的过程:
求出包含新插入点p 外接圆的三角形; 求出包含新插入点p的外接圆的三角形; 的三角形 删除影响三角形的公共边; 删除影响三角形的公共边; 影响三角形的公共边 与全部影响三角形的顶点连接 将p与全部影响三角形的顶点连接。 与全部影响三角形的顶点连接。
构建TIN比较费时; 比较费时; 构建 比较费时 算法设计比较复杂; 算法设计比较复杂; 复杂 表面分析能力较差。 表面分析能力较差。 能力较差
长沙理工大学测绘工程系 谢树春
不规则三角网DEM 不规则三角网DEM
思考: 思考:
能否结合规则格网 DEM和不规则三角网 和不规则三角网 DEM各自的优点? 各自的优点 各自的优点?
不规则三角网DEM 不规则三角网DEM
基于张角最大准则的Delaunay三角网建立 五. 基于张角最大准则的 三角网建立

不规则角网(TIN)的建立

不规则角网(TIN)的建立
5.2.1 无约束散点域的三角剖分算法与实现
5.2 TIN的建立
目前散点域的三角剖分使用最为广泛的算法是 Delaunay直接三角剖分算法。 根据实现过程,把DT分成三类:
1)三角网生长算法 2)逐点插入算法
3)分割合并算法
2019/2/7 28
第5章 不规则三角网(TIN)的建立
1、三角网生长算法
目前这类算法主要有地形骨架法、地形滤波 法等。
2019/2/7 23
• 地形骨架法:
– 利用地形特征点、线建立地形的骨架模型, 然后对其进行插点,达到预定的精度;
• 地表滤波法:
– 将格网DEM看作为一幅数字图像,可使用空 间高通滤波器对其滤波,保留图像中的高频 信息,即为地形特征点,滤掉低频信息也即 对地形特征而言不重要的点,在此基础上建 立TIN模型。
2019/2/7 24
第5章 不规则三角网(TIN)的建立
5.1.3 三角剖分算法分类与特点
5.1 TIN概述
从混合数据生成三角网(P70)
混合数据:是指链状数据 (如断裂线、河流线等)与规 则格网采样数据结合形成的一 种数据。
此种数据建立三角网的方法: 首先分解规则三角形,然后考 虑特征线上的点,在格网中生 成不规则三角形。
2019/2/7
根据规则数据建成的三角形格网
22
第5章 不规则三角网(TIN)的建立
5.1.3 三角剖分算法分类与特点
5.1 TIN概述
规则分布采样数据三角剖分
重要点法DEM建模有两个关键步骤: 1)确定格网点的“重要程度”:全局最重要或局 部最重要; 2)确定终止条件:达到预设的点数或预设的精度、 或两者折中。
2019/2/7 15

不规则三角网(TIN)的建立分析

不规则三角网(TIN)的建立分析
TIN描述地形表面的基本单元。TIN中的每一个三角形都描 述了局部地形倾斜状态,具有唯一的坡度值。三角形在公 共节点和边上是无缝的,或者说三角形不能交叉和重叠。
2018/10/22 5
数据和TIN的类型
用来进行TIN构建的原始数据根据数据点之间的约束 条件可分为无约束数据域和约束数据域两种类型。
2018/10/22
3
不规则三角网(TIN)的建立
T:三角化( Triangulated )是离散数据的三角剖分 过程,也是TIN的建立过程。位于三角形内的任意一点 的高程值均可以通过三角形平面方程唯一确定。 I:不规则性( Irregular ),指用来构建TIN的采样 点的分布形式。TIN具有可变分辨率,比格网DEM能更 好反映地形起伏。 N:网( Network ),表达整个区域的三角形分布形 态,即三角形之间不能交叉和重叠。三角形之间的拓 扑关系隐含其中。
平方之比最小。
对角线准则:两三角形组成的凸四边形的两条对角线之比。这一准
则的比值限定值,须给定,即当计算值超过限定值才进行优化。
2018/10/22
10
说明:
1)三角形准则是建立三角形格网的基本原 则,应用不同的准则将会得到不同的三角网。 2)一般而言,应尽量保持三角网的唯一性, 即在同一准则下由不同的位置开始建立三角 形格网,其最终的形状和结构应是相同的。 3)空外接圆准则、最大最小角准则下进行 的三角剖分称为Delaunay (译为狄洛尼或德 劳内)三角剖分(Triangulation),简称DT。 空外接圆准则也叫Delaunay法则。
扩张生长算法与收缩算法过程刚好相反,是从一个 三角形开始向外层层扩展,形成覆盖整个区域的三角 网。
2018/10/22 15

第三章 不规则三角网

第三章 不规则三角网
详见演示
小结
不规则三角网络是描述三维表面的常用方法,除了在地形方面,还可以用于其他各种领域。在不规则三角网上还可以叠加其它空间要素,同时以三维方式显示。
5.2工程中的土方、纵坡
一、由等高线产生不规则三角网
使用数据:设计等高线、现状等高线、场地边界线
扩展模块:3D Analyst
所用命令:Surface/Create TIN from Features
三、从3D Shapefile生成三维纵剖面
所用数据:TIN专题“地形”,线状矢量专题“道路”。
扩展模块:3D Analyst
所用命令:Theme/Convert to 3D Shapefile…
操作步骤:
1.生成3D Shapefile
2.建立Layout(地图布局窗口)
3.利用剖面图绘制工具绘制沿道路的地形纵剖面
一般情况下,不规则三角网(TIN)是从高程点产生的,如果靠传统地图建立TIN,就要利用等高线,这时软件就在等高线上取出典型的、关键的样本点,将这些样本点连起来形成TIN,这比直接从高程点产生TIN在计算方法上多了一个自动选取样本点的步骤。
一般情况下显示TIN时表达高程,但是也可以直接计算表达坡度,还可以直接进行简单的填挖方计算。如果要进行细致的填挖方计算,就要将TIN转换成栅格在计算。
命令:View/3D Scene…,对系统的提示选择Themes,按OK键后系统产生3D Scenes Themes Document,该子系统具有自己的三维视图窗口和图例框,可用鼠标点击按钮Navigate(形状像帆船),再用鼠标在三维窗口中控制观察地形的三维视角。
在三维场景中,选用菜单命令Theme/3D Properties…
5.3视线与视域分析

不规则三角网的建立与应用

不规则三角网的建立与应用

摘要作为空间数据基础设施中的“4D”产品之一和地理信息系统的核心数据库,数字高程模型(DEM)已在测绘、遥感、农林规划、城市规划、土木水利工程、地学分析等各个领域都有了广泛的应用。

数字高程模型的表示方法主要有规则格网模型、不规则三角网模型和等高线模型三种,而不规则三角网(TIN)是数字高程模型中最基本和最重要的一种模型,它能以不同层次的分辨率来描述地形表面,并可以灵活的处理特殊地形。

因此,围绕基于TIN 的DEM 的构建,本文主要论述了基于 TIN 结构的数字高程模型建模原理和方法,离散点的Delaunay 三角网生成算法,建立有约束条件的约束三角网,最后分析了建立的 TIN模型在土方计算方面的应用。

在本论文论述的过程中,针对传统算法进行了对比和分析后,在逐点插入法的基础之上,提出了一些新的细部改进的实现方法。

局部优化操作和改进的算法实现使得对大容量离散点的三角网构建速度更快,效率更高;对限制条件的嵌入满足由此计算出来的土方量更接近实际期望值。

本论文中主要的研究成果和内容如下: 1)在离散点的 Delaunay 三角网生成方面,本文中在插入点算法的基础上,建立凸包和矩形包容盒,建立虚拟网格,对原始离散点进行一级格网自适应分块,并建立索引关系。

在定位点所在三角形时引入快速点定位算法,简易的空外接圆及圆内测试公式,通过这些改进使得 Delaunay 三角网的剖分更加高效。

2)在约束 Delaunay 三角网理论基础之上,结合上面散点域的剖分方法,对已有的两步算法基础上改进,完成约束 Delaunay 三角网的构建。

在其过程中应用矢量点积等数学工具改善了计算中的凹凸点判断,继续采用上章的快速索引和最速定位方法,并且对约束线相切等特殊情形进行了处理,进一步完善了算法的稳健性。

3)对于在约束三角网构造基础上的 TIN 模型的应用,文中对其在土方量计算方面精度的优越性进行了分析,在可视化表达方面最后结合广东省东莞市某高尔夫球场工程给出了例证。

不规则三角网(TIN)的建立

不规则三角网(TIN)的建立
数字高程模型
不规则三角网(TIN)的建立算法
马仕航 1410040222
2016/11/20
1
TIN概述
5.1.1 TIN的理解 5.1.2 TIN的三角剖分准则
5.1.3

三角剖分算法分类与特
2016/11/20
2
TIN的基本概念
不规则三角网(Triangulated Irregular Network 简称TIN):是用一系列互不交叉、互不重叠的连接在一 起的三角形来表示地形表面。TIN既是矢量结构又有栅格 的空间铺盖特征,能很好地描述和维护空间关系。
20
2、逐点插入算法 :
• 1)定义包含所有数据点的最小外界矩形范围,并以此作 为最简单的凸闭包。 • 2)按一定规则将数据区域的矩形范围进行格网划分(如 限定每个格网单元的数据点数)。 • 3)剖分数据区域的凸闭包形成两个超三角形,所有数据 点都一定在这两个三角形范围内。 • 4)对所有数据点进行循环,作如下工作(设当前处理的 数据点为P):
将等高线作为特征线的方法;
自动增加特征点及优化TIN的方法。
2016/11/20
25
等高线离散点直接生成TIN方法
该方法直接将等高线离散化,然后利用常用TIN的生成 算法,该方法没有考虑离散点间原有的连接关系,模拟 的地形就会失真,具体表现为三角形的边穿越等高线和 存在平三角形的两种情况。 在实际应用中该方法较少使用。
无约束数据域是指数据点之间不存在任何关系,即 数据分布完全呈离散状态,数据点之间在物理上相互 独立。
约束数据域则是部分数据点之间存在着某种联系, 这种联系一般通过线性特征来维护,如地形数据中的 山脊线、山谷线上的点等。
2016/11/20
  1. 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
  2. 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
  3. 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
⒍ 不规则三角网模型IN模型是用于表达地理空间连续现象的数据模型; ▪ 它用大小不一的不规则三角形逼近地形表面;可以减少用规
则的栅格表达地形带来的数据冗余; ▪ 利用这一模型,可以方便的进行地形分析
▪ 坡度、坡向、填挖土方的计算 ▪ 阴影和地形通视分析
TIN 的基本概念
▪ 三角形有坡向、坡度和面积属性
断线 (Breakline)
▪ 断线是定义和控制了地形面行为的线段。沿着断线,高程值 可以是常数,也可以变化。
▪ 分类:硬断线、断层、软断线
硬断线
▪ 硬断线定义了地形面上平滑度的中断。 ▪ 可用于定义河流、山脊线,岸线,建筑物底部的轮廓线,水
坝等地面突然变化。
▪ 如河流,顺流而下,高程值递减,断线两侧,都呈现平展的地貌形 态,但坡向相反。
TIN 的拓扑结构
▪ 记录:三角形法(上) 或节点法(下)
输入线段
忽略输入线 段的高程
计算了输入 线段的高程
ID S b(x,y,z) T c(x,y,z) U d(x,y,z) V e(x,y,z) W a(x,y,z)
……
顶点坐标 c(x,y,z) e(x,y,z) d(x,y,z) e(x,y,z) f(x,y,z) e(x,y,z) f(x,y,z) g(x,y,z) e(x,y,z) g(x,y,z)
断层
▪ 断层是地面连续性的中断。 ▪ 在断层,地面可能发生垂直位移,形成阶状地貌。这样就可
能出现在同一地点有两个高程值(即 x,y 坐标相同,而有 两个 z 值) 。 ▪ 处理:沿断层走向增加两条略分开的断线
软断线
▪ 软断线被用于确保沿线形要素已知的高程值能够在TIN结构 中存在。
▪ 如:山坡上的公路
▪ 节点(Node):
▪ 是一个或一个以上三角形的顶点。 ▪ 节点有(x,y,z)坐标。
▪ 边(Edge):
▪ 边无坐标,但有两个节点。 ▪ 除了边缘三角形的边缘边,每条边是两个三角形的公共边。 ▪ 因节点有高度,故边有坡度。
▪ 狄洛尼三角形(Delaunay):
▪ 其外接圆内不包含其它离散点,即每个节点都是和其最近邻的两个节点形成三 角形。
相邻三角形ID X, T X, U T, V U, W X, V, Y
ID 坐标 a x,y,z b c d e
……
相邻顶点ID b,e,g,h
相关文档
最新文档